If you’re a Skilled Occupational Therapist curious about Travel job trends in Florissant, MO,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 2 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$1,747 and a range from $1,482 to $2,122 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.
Positions were located in key zip codes, including 63031.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Skilled Occupational Therapists in Florissant’s thriving healthcare landscape. As a Skilled Occupational Therapist in Florissant, Missouri, you can expect to engage in a diverse range of therapeutic services across various facilities, including outpatient clinics, rehabilitation centers, skilled nursing facilities, and inpatient hospitals. Your role will involve assessing and treating patients with physical, cognitive, and emotional challenges, helping them improve their ability to perform daily activities and achieve greater independence. You may work with a wide demographic, from pediatrics to geriatrics, utilizing a client-centered approach to develop individualized treatment plans that incorporate innovative techniques and adaptive equipment. Additionally, opportunities for collaboration with interdisciplinary teams will enhance your professional growth and contribute to comprehensive patient care in this vibrant community.

Candidates for a Skilled Occupational Therapy travel job in Florissant, Missouri typically require a valid state license and relevant clinical experience, ideally in settings such as hospitals or rehabilitation facilities. Preferred qualifications often include specialized certifications and a demonstrated ability to adapt to different environments and patient needs.
Skilled Occupational Therapy travel jobs in Florissant, Missouri, are typically offered in rehabilitation centers, hospitals, and skilled nursing facilities. These environments provide essential services to support patients in regaining their independence and functionality.
For Skilled Occupational Therapy Travel jobs in Florissant, MO, typical contract durations range from 13 weeks. These flexible contract lengths allow you to choose an assignment that best fits your career goals and lifestyle preferences.
A Skilled Occupational Therapist seeking a travel job in Florissant, Missouri, should inquire about comprehensive benefits such as housing stipends, travel reimbursements, and malpractice insurance coverage. Additionally, support for continuing education opportunities and a robust onboarding process can greatly enhance their professional experience while on assignment.
